THE ROLE


As part of continued business growth, my client has immediate requirements for an experienced and dynamic Product Manager, instrumental in delivering products to the market and with proven success in overseeing all elements of the product development lifecycle.


Skilled in market analysis and with responsibility for understanding customer needs, gaps in the market, and emerging market trends. The Product Manager is the bridge between the markets needs and the software development team, ensuring that the product roadmap and subsequent software developments meet the customer demands and drive business growth.


THE PERSON


At least 3 years commercial experience in a similar product manager capacity, ideally from an industrial IT, engineering or industrial control systems background

Drive the product planning processes from design concept of both product and features roadmaps through to development, customer feedback and end of life ensuring timely delivery of product features

Analyse customer needs, current market trends, and potential partnerships offerings from a build-vs.-buy perspective

Analyse product requirements and develop appropriate user stories for the development team

Experienced in delivering product marketing strategies (go-to-market plans) with a commercial understanding of channel based / two-tier partnerships

Translate product strategy into detailed requirements for prototyping and final development by engineering teams, including validationof test cases

Create product strategy documents that describe business cases, high-level use cases, technical requirements, budget monitoring and return on investment value proposition

Manage the products cost benefit analysis and measure its commercial success

Be the product champion within the business by presenting at events (UK and overseas), including promotion of the products within the marketplace
